The Early Days of Al Pacino

Al Pacino, one of the most celebrated actors in the history of cinema, has a rich and compelling backstory that is reflected in his young photos. Born on April 25, 1940, in East Harlem, New York, Pacino grew up in a challenging environment that shaped his character and passion for acting.
